Brazilian Port Congestion Disrupts Agribusiness Exports

Brazilian Port Congestion Disrupts Agribusiness Exports

Brazilian port infrastructure is facing extreme strain, causing logistics congestion and significant losses for agricultural exports. Insufficient infrastructure investment, bureaucracy, and lagging digitalization exacerbate the problem. Coordinated action between the government and private sector is needed to increase investment and promote digital transformation to improve port efficiency and ensure Brazil's competitiveness in the global market. Shippers and freight forwarders should closely monitor port dynamics, plan ahead, and choose reliable logistics partners.

Publicprivate Partnerships Ease Port Dredging Backlogs

Publicprivate Partnerships Ease Port Dredging Backlogs

US ports face challenges in dredged material management. The Port of Baltimore is exploring a public-private partnership model, leveraging private sector technology and funding to reuse dredged material, reducing costs and environmental pollution. This involves transforming dredged sediments into beneficial products. Other ports are also experimenting with similar innovative approaches, promoting sustainable port development. This model offers a potential solution for addressing the increasing volumes of dredged material and the associated environmental concerns, while also fostering economic growth and resource efficiency.

Nansha Port Tightens Hazardous Materials Oversight

Nansha Port Tightens Hazardous Materials Oversight

Guangzhou Nansha Port is tightening its control over dangerous goods, strictly prohibiting concealment and false declaration. Violators will face penalties including termination of cooperation and bearing all losses. This measure aims to maintain port operational order, ensure maritime transport safety, and prevent casualties and property damage. The upgrade emphasizes stricter enforcement and accountability to deter illegal activities related to dangerous goods handling within the port area, ultimately contributing to a safer and more secure environment for all stakeholders.
